Bomb conversation delays flight in Turkey

A conversation about a bomb notice between two passengers delayed a flight at Istanbul Atatürk
Airport early on June 2. The stewardess warned the pilot after hearing
the conversation and bomb disposal teams were called to the plane.

The
flight, scheduled to fly to Kyiv at 6:05 a.m., was delayed when two
passengers said that there was a bomb notice for a flight on June 3.

“There is a bomb notice for the flight tomorrow,” said the unidentified passengers as they entered the plane. 

The plane was evacuated and taken to a safe area where it was searched.

The plane took off around 9:05 a.m. after no explosives were found.
